Comprehending Bail and Its Purpose
The legal system can be intricate, comprehending Bail and its objective is necessary for individuals going across criminal fees. Bail acts as a system to guarantee that offenders appear in court while enabling them to keep their flexibility throughout the legal procedure. By posting Bail, a charged individual can avoid pre-trial detention, which can be monetarily and mentally straining. The amount established for Bail is commonly established by a court, taking into consideration factors such as the extent of the criminal activity, the offender's criminal background, and the probability of getting away. Eventually, Bail aims to stabilize the legal rights of the accused with the interests of public safety and security and the judicial procedure, ensuring accountability while maintaining private freedoms up until a judgment is reached.
Just How Bail Bond Solutions Work
Bail bond solutions play an essential role in the Bail procedure for those unable to pay for the full Bail quantity established by the court. When an individual is jailed, the court identifies a bail amount based on the severity of the costs and the person's flight danger. If the implicated can not pay this amount, they can seek support from a bond bondsman. The bondsman typically charges a portion of the overall Bail as a fee and provides to cover the continuing to be quantity. In return, the implicated should concur to specific conditions, consisting of showing up in court as needed. This system allows people to protect their release while waiting for test, ensuring they maintain their flexibility and continue with their day-to-days live.

Cost of Bail Bonds
Recognizing the cost of Bail bonds is essential for individuals traversing the criminal justice system, as these expenses can significantly affect financial stability. Normally, bail bond solutions bill a costs, generally around 10% of the total Bail amount set by the court. This fee is non-refundable, no matter of the instance's end result. Additional expenses might arise, such as management charges or collateral requirements, depending on the bond's specifics. The financial worry of safeguarding a bond can be significant, specifically for those with minimal resources. People must assess their financial scenario carefully, as the obligations linked with Bail bonds can lead to additional financial stress if not handled effectively. Recognizing these costs is essential for educated decision-making.

The Influence of Bail on the Justice System
Bail is typically seen as a simple procedural step in the legal process, its ramifications extend far beyond the court, substantially forming the justice system. Bail works as a crucial mechanism for stabilizing individual civil liberties with public security, permitting defendants to stay totally free while awaiting test. This system affects case results, as pretrial apprehension can result in harsher sentences, coerced appeal offers, and enhanced likelihood of sentence. Additionally, Bail overmuch influences low-income people, adding to systemic inequalities within the justice system. The accessibility of Bail influences police techniques and judicial treatments, as it can figure out exactly how situations are prioritized and resources designated. Ultimately, Bail plays a crucial duty in forming the experiences of offenders and the wider performance of justice.
Alternatives to Bail Bond Services
The intricacies surrounding Bail click to investigate have actually prompted conversations regarding choices to typical bail bond solutions. One significant choice is using pretrial release programs, which enable accuseds to remain complimentary while awaiting trial under details conditions. These programs typically include regular check-ins with a managing officer. In addition, some territories have executed threat evaluation devices to examine an offender's possibility of reoffending, enabling judges to make educated launch choices without requiring Bail. An additional alternative consists of launch on recognizance, where individuals assure to show up in court without the need for financial Bail. Area support programs likewise contribute, providing resources to help offenders fulfill court needs. These choices intend to minimize the economic burden on people and boost overall justice end results.

What Occurs if the Charged Stops Working to Show Up in Court?
If the accused fails to appear in court, a warrant might be provided for their apprehension. Additionally, any Bail posted might be surrendered, resulting in punitive damages for the bail bond solution and the accused.
Can Bail Bond Providers Be Utilized for Any Kind Of Kind Of Infraction?
Bail bond services are usually applicable to different offenses, consisting of felonies and violations. Particular significant costs, such as resources offenses or those with no Bail option, might restrict their use, restricting availability for certain scenarios.
For how long Does the Bail Bond Process Typically Take?
The bail bond process normally takes a couple of hours to a day, depending on the complexity of the instance and the accessibility of the necessary documentation. Variables like territory and court timetables can influence this timeline.
Are Bail Bond Costs Refundable After Court Process?
Bail bond charges are typically taken into consideration non-refundable, as they make up the bond representative for their services. Also if the accused is acquitted, the costs typically continue to be with the bonding business, reflecting the threat entailed.
